1947 Austin A 125 vs. 2012 BMW 640

To start off, 2012 BMW 640 is newer by 65 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1947 Austin A 125.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1947 Austin A 125 would be higher. At 3,990 cc (6 cylinders), 1947 Austin A 125 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2012 BMW 640 (311 HP) has 186 more horse power than 1947 Austin A 125. (125 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2012 BMW 640 should accelerate faster than 1947 Austin A 125.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1947 Austin A 125 weights approximately 270 kg more than 2012 BMW 640.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. 2012 BMW 640 has automatic transmission and 1947 Austin A 125 has manual transmission. 1947 Austin A 125 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2012 BMW 640 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.

Compare all specifications:

1947 Austin A 125 2012 BMW 640
Make Austin BMW
Model A 125 640
Year Released 1947 2012
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 3990 cc 2993 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 125 HP 311 HP
Drive Type Rear Rear
Transmission Type Manual 8-speed shiftable automatic
Number of Seats 7 seats 4 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 2060 kg 1790 kg
Vehicle Length 5200 mm 4894 mm
Vehicle Width 1860 mm 1894 mm
Wheelbase Size 3360 mm 2855 mm
